Cabot Oil & Gas Corporation dividend investors are looking at a natural gas producer focused almost entirely on the Marcellus Shale in Susquehanna County, Pennsylvania. COG pays a quarterly dividend, with a trailing annual rate of $0.42 per share and an ex-dividend date of August 11, 2021. The current yield sits at 1.89%. With a beta of 0.142, COG stock moves far less than the broader market, which suits investors who want energy exposure without sharp price swings.
Cabot Oil & Gas Corporation pays out 40.4% of earnings as dividends, a payout ratio classified as moderate (40-60%). That level leaves meaningful room to sustain payments even if natural gas prices soften, given that COG's operations are concentrated in a single, well-defined acreage position in the Marcellus Shale. Cabot Oil & Gas Corporation dividend safety faces its most direct pressure from commodity price volatility, since revenue from natural gas sales to industrial consumers, utilities, and power generators moves with market prices, not fixed contracts.
Cabot Oil & Gas Corporation dividend history shows a CAGR of 16.2% per year from 2013 to 2020. Per-share payments grew from $0.14 to $0.40 over that window (2021 data is partial and excluded from the rate calculation). The largest single-year jump was 70.0% in 2017, though the history also contains at least one year-over-year decline exceeding 5%, so the growth path has not been linear.
